7‑Day Affordable Thailand Adventure from Chennai

Viewed by 136 travelers

Day 1: Arrival & First Exploration in Bangkok

Morning: Fly from Chennai to Bangkok (Suvarnabhumi Airport) on an early low‑cost carrier; the flight takes about 3½ hours. After arrival, take the Airport Rail Link to Phaya Thai and check into a budget hostel near Khao San Road (≈ ₹800 per night per person).

Afternoon: Grab a quick lunch of pad thai and mango sticky rice at a nearby street stall, then stroll to the Grand Palace and the adjoining Wat Pho to see the Reclining Buddha.

Evening: Dive into the vibrant atmosphere of Khao San Road – enjoy cheap cocktails, live music, and a bustling night market for souvenir hunting.

Day 2: Bangkok City Highlights

Morning: Hop on the BTS Skytrain to Jim Thompson House for a quick cultural glimpse, then head to the Chatuchak Weekend Market (open Saturday‑Sunday) for affordable shopping and street‑food tasting.

Afternoon: Explore the bustling alleys of Chinatown (Yaowarat), sampling delicacies like oyster omelette and roasted duck.

Evening: Attend the spectacular Siam Niramit Show, a budget‑friendly cultural performance (≈ ₹1,500 per person) followed by a late‑night walk along Asiatique Riverfront for riverside drinks.

Day 3: Ayutthaya Day Trip

Morning: Take a cheap 1‑hour train from Hua Lamphong to Ayutthaya and rent bicycles (≈ ₹150 per bike) to explore the ancient ruins.

Afternoon: Visit the iconic Wat Mahathat (the Buddha head entwined in roots) and Wat Chaiwatthanaram, enjoying a packed lunch of Thai fried rice.

Evening: Return to Bangkok, relax at the hostel, and enjoy a low‑cost dinner of tom yum goong at a local eatery.

Day 4: Travel to Pattaya & Beach Time

Morning: Board an affordable minibus (≈ ₹300 per person) to Pattaya (2 hours). Check into a seaside guesthouse near Pattaya Beach (≈ ₹850 per night per person).

Afternoon: Unwind on Pattaya Beach, try cheap water activities like banana‑boat rides, and snack on grilled squid.

Evening: Explore the lively Walking Street, sampling street‑food barbecues and enjoying inexpensive bars with live music.

Day 5: Pattaya Attractions

Morning: Visit the impressive Sanctuary of Truth (entry ≈ ₹1,200 per person) to admire intricate wood carvings.

Afternoon: Head to the Floating Market (Baan Tung Roh) for a boat ride and tasting fresh tropical fruits and coconut ice‑cream.

Evening: Return to Walking Street for a budget-friendly night out at Cheap Cheers Pub, where drinks start at ₹150.

Day 6: Return to Bangkok – Shopping & Nightlife

Morning: Travel back to Bangkok by minibus; drop luggage at the hostel and freshen up.

Afternoon: Spend time at MBK Center for affordable electronics and souvenirs; grab a bowl of spicy boat noodles from a food court.

Evening: Experience the neon‑lit Soi Cowboy area for a glimpse of Bangkok’s nightlife (window‑shopping only, no entry fee) and end the night at a rooftop bar with happy‑hour drinks.

Day 7: Final Day & Departure

Morning: Enjoy a leisurely brunch of khao man gai (chicken rice) at a local café near the hostel.

Afternoon: Take a final stroll through Lumphini Park for relaxation and photo opportunities.

Evening: Head to Suvarnabhumi Airport via the Airport Rail Link for the return flight to Chennai.

Time and Cost Estimates

  • Round‑trip flight (Chennai‑Bangkok) – 1 day total travel – ₹10,000 per person
  • Accommodation (budget hostel, 7 nights) – 7 nights – ₹5,600 per person
  • Food & Street Eats – 7 days – ₹3,500 per person
  • Grand Palace & Wat Pho entry – 2 hrs – ₹400 per person
  • Siam Niramit Show – 2 hrs – ₹1,500 per person
  • Chatuchak Market (BTS pass) – 3 hrs – ₹300 per person
  • Ayutthaya train + bike rental – 8 hrs – ₹700 per person
  • Ayutthaya temple entries – 3 hrs – ₹350 per person
  • Minibus to/from Pattaya – 2 days – ₹600 per person
  • Sanctuary of Truth entry – 2 hrs – ₹1,200 per person
  • Floating Market boat ride – 2 hrs – ₹250 per person
  • Pattaya beach activities (banana boat) – 2 hrs – ₹300 per person
  • Nightlife & drinks (Bangkok & Pattaya) – 4 evenings – ₹2,000 per person
  • Local transport (BTS, taxis, tuk‑tuks) – 7 days – ₹1,500 per person
  • Total Estimated Cost – – ₹30,000 per person (≈ ₹180,000 for 6 friends)

Tips

If you wish to extend the trip, consider adding a day in Chiang Mai for mountain trekking and night‑market fun, which can be done on a budget using overnight buses. To shorten the itinerary, skip the Pattaya leg and spend the extra day exploring more of Bangkok’s hidden gems like the Talat Rot Fai night market, reducing accommodation and transport costs while still enjoying a full Thai experience.
